Historical Perspective: The Roots of Mobile Gaming
Mobile gaming’s origins trace back to basic games like Snake on Nokia phones, which engaged users with minimal graphics and limited gameplay mechanics. These early titles prioritized simplicity and memorability, creating a foundation for widespread adoption. As mobile devices matured, developers began exploring more complex gaming experiences, incorporating elements such as multiplayer support and richer visual effects.
Technological Advancements Fueling Growth
Modern smartphones now feature high-refresh-rate screens, multi-core processors, and advanced GPU capabilities. This hardware evolution enables the rendering of detailed 3D environments, realistic physics, and immersive audio, fundamentally changing the gamer’s experience. Simultaneously, 5G connectivity offers low latency gaming on the go, fostering seamless multiplayer interactions and real-time updates.
The Rise of Mobile Game Genres and Specializations
Today’s mobile game ecosystem is highly diversified. Action titles, battle royales, puzzle games, and augmented reality (AR) experiences all thrive within this space. Games like “PUBG Mobile” and “Genshin Impact” demonstrate how complex narratives and high-fidelity graphics can be optimized for mobile platforms, breaking free from the traditional constraints of mobile gaming.
Integrating Social and Cloud Technologies
Social integration allows players to connect effortlessly with friends, clans, or worldwide communities, enhancing engagement and competition. Additionally, cloud gaming services such as Google Stadia, Xbox Cloud Gaming, and others enable players to stream games directly from servers, significantly reducing device limitations and expanding accessibility.
Emerging Trends and Future Directions
Looking ahead, technologies like augmented reality (AR), virtual reality (VR), and artificial intelligence (AI) are poised to further revolutionize mobile gaming. For instance, AR games like “Pokémon GO” have already demonstrated the potential of blending real-world environments with digital gameplay, inspiring new forms of interactive entertainment.

Choosing the Right Platform for Mobile Gaming
As the industry evolves, understanding the landscape of available platforms becomes crucial for developers and consumers. Platforms differ in hardware capabilities, app store policies, monetization models, and community engagement tools. The development and distribution strategies for mobile gaming are increasingly integrated with online communities and third-party resources.
| Platform Features | Details |
|---|---|
| Android | Open ecosystem, extensive device compatibility, large market share |
| iOS | Premium device hardware, curated app store, high monetization potential |
| Cloud Gaming | Stream games via high-speed internet, bypass device hardware limitations |
